Paul Bodart - DEXIA SA Independent Director

Director

Mr. Paul Bodart has served as Independent Director of Dexia SA since December 31 2012. He held positions at the Banque Europeenne pour lAmerique latine Morgan and the Euroclear Operations Centre. He joined The Bank of New York on January 1 1996 as a Senior Vice President to become the General Manager of the Brussels Branch of the Bank. He was responsible for Global Custody operations. He was promoted Executive Vice President on January 1 2003. Mr. Bodart was Executive Vice President and CEO of BNY Mellon SANV Head of EMEA Global Operations until September 2012. In September 2012 he became a member of the T2S Committee of the European Central Bank. In 2014 he was independent director of National Settlement Depository the Russian central depository. He also serves as Director of Dexia Credit Local Chairman of the Board of Directors of the Compagnie des Septs Bonniers Member of the Board of various nonprofitmaking associations since 2012.

Bodart obtained his engineering degree at the Catholic University of Louvain in 1976 and a master degree of business administration in 1987 at INSEAD. He is Chairman of the Audit Committee and Member of the Compensation Committee.

Elected by the shareholders, the DEXIA SA's board of directors comprises two types of representatives: DEXIA SA inside directors who are chosen from within the company, and outside directors, selected externally and held independent of DEXIA. The board's role is to monitor DEXIA SA's management team and ensure that shareholders' interests are well served. DEXIA SA's inside directors are responsible for reviewing and approving budgets prepared by upper management to implement core corporate initiatives and projects. On the other hand, DEXIA SA's outside directors are responsible for providing unbiased perspectives on the board's policies.

Pair Trading with DEXIA SA

One of the main advantages of trading using pair correlations is that every trade hedges away some risk. Because there are two separate transactions required, even if DEXIA SA position performs unexpectedly, the other equity can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market. For example, if an entire industry or sector drops because of unexpected headlines, the short position in DEXIA SA will appreciate offsetting losses from the drop in the long position's value.

The correlation of Microsoft is a statistical measure of how it moves in relation to other instruments. This measure is expressed in what is known as the correlation coefficient, which ranges between -1 and +1. A perfect positive correlation (i.e., a correlation coefficient of +1) implies that as Microsoft moves, either up or down, the other security will move in the same direction. Alternatively, perfect negative correlation means that if Microsoft moves in either direction, the perfectly negatively correlated security will move in the opposite direction. If the correlation is 0, the equities are not correlated; they are entirely random. A correlation greater than 0.8 is generally described as strong, whereas a correlation less than 0.5 is generally considered weak.
